Matthias Richter (German pronunciation: [maˈtiːas ʀɪçtɐ]; born 18 January 1988), better known by his stage name Tujamo, is a German DJ and electro house music producer. Tujamo, along with Plastik Funk and Sneakbo, released the single " Dr. Who!", which peaked at number 21 on the UK Singles Chart. [1] He also had a hit with Steve Aoki and Chris Lake, [2] " Boneless", which charted at #49 on the German Singles Chart and #42 on the Austrian Singles Chart.

Background

Tujamo performing at Airbeat One 2017

Tujamo was born Matthias Richter in 1988 in Detmold, North Rhine-Westphalia. [3] He began DJing at age 17 and in 2006 participated in and won a talent competition hosted by Club Index in Schüttorf, where he became a resident DJ. [3] He began using the Tujamo moniker that same year and released his debut single, "Mombasa", in 2011. [3] His first hit, " Who", was originally released in 2011 in collaboration with Plastik Funk, also from Germany. [3] It became a large hit at the Winter Music Conference, a Miami house club. [3] In 2014, his single "Boneless", released in collaboration with Steve Aoki and Chris Lake, charted at number 49 on the German Singles Chart [3] and number 42 on the Dutch Singles Chart. [4] The same year, he reworked "Who" as " Dr. Who!" with vocals from British rapper Sneakbo and it charted at number 21 on the UK Singles Chart, receiving support from Avicii, Tiësto, Fedde Le Grand and Steve Aoki. [3] He has also remixed songs by Bob Sinclar, Peter Gelderblom and Wynter Gordon and has played all over Germany and globally, including South America, [3] Turkey, Brazil and Russia. [5] Some of his other singles include "How We Roll", "Do It All Night", "Back 2 You" and a cover version of Laserkraft 3D's "Nein Mann". [6]

Beatport

In 2019, Tujamo became the all-time best-selling artist of the electro house genre at Beatport. [7]
